Transaction 66e7f41c4730607626431e8c07b6ff4501c4f3d82626a13a8abe540b5fde3a4e
1 Input
1 Output
-
66e7f41c4730607626431e8c07b6ff4501c4f3d82626a13a8abe540b5fde3a4e:0
- value
- 34530189
- script pubkey
- OP_0 OP_PUSHBYTES_20 6adb3bb524b196d3d8c82e7de714b99375d09baa
- address
- bc1qdtdnhdfykxtd8kxg9e77w99ejd6apxa2lpjev3